Unequal Angles - 100x50x8
Steel unequal angles are L-shaped structural steel bars where one leg is longer than the other. Also known as "unequal angle irons," their asymmetrical design makes them incredibly efficient when a structure needs more strength or surface area in one direction than the other. This unequal shape allows engineers to save weight and reduce material costs compared to using a larger, heavier equal angle. They are commonly used as robust lintels over windows and doors, brackets for heavy brickwork, and bracing elements in roof trusses or steel towers.

Dimensions
| Property | Value |
|---|---|
| A mm | 100 |
| B mm | 50 |
| t mm | 8 |
| kg/m | 8.97 |
| r1 mm | 8 |
| r2 mm | 4 |

Section Properties
| Property | Value |
|---|---|
| Dimension - cx | 3.6 |
| Dimension - cy | 1.13 |
| Second Moment of Area (x-x) - cm4 | 116 |
| Second Moment of Area (y-y) - cm4 | 19.7 |
| Second Moment of Area (u-u) - cm4 | 123 |
| Second Moment of Area (v-v) - cm4 | 12.8 |
| Radius of Gyration (x-x) - cm | 3.19 |
| Radius of Gyration (y-y) - cm | 1.31 |
| Radius of Gyration (u-u) - cm | 3.28 |
| Radius of Gyration (v-v) - cm | 1.06 |
| Elastic Modulus (x-x) - cm3 | 18.2 |
| Elastic Modulus (y-y) - cm3 | 5.08 |
| Angle Axis x-x to u-u - Tan α | 0.258 |
| Torsional Constant - J cm4 | 2.61 |
| Equivalent Slenderness Coefficient (Min) - φa | 3.30 |
| Equivalent Slenderness Coefficient (Max) - φa | 4.80 |
| Mono-symmetry Index - ψa | 8.61 |
| Area of Section - cm2 | 11.4 |
